Job Description:

Carestaff Solutions are looking for passionate, committed, enthusiastic, experienced children and young people residential workers.

Our clients put the care, wellbeing and education of children first and our workers reflect that child-centred approach when on shifts, so whether they are working on one shift at the last minutes or working on a rolling contract the Carestaff team member is as effective as the permanent of the team.

Here at Carestaff Solutions we know that its a privilege to work with children and young people who need our support, our aim is to improve the lives of the children and young people we work with, and in turn have a positive effect on their wider relationships.

Duties:

  • Work within, and ensure effective delivery of the policies and procedures in the client environment.
  • Monitor and maintain administrative requirements, ensuring that the outcome meets the standards set out in children’s legislation, and the homes working practices.
  • Promote and actively encourage the delivery of a safe, structured and nurturing environment.
  • Proactively engage with young people who display challenging behaviour.
  • Assist young people to identify unsafe, dangerous, harmful and abusive situations, individuals and groups.
  • At all times ensure the health, safety and wellbeing of the children and young people.
  • Ensure a variety of intervention strategies are utilised in relation to behaviour management.
  • Ensure an open culture is created with the young people in the care of the end client.
  • Ensure that the child or young person is safe in terms of safeguarding protocols.
